Welcome to the inaugural issue of Nature Cell and Science (NCS), which sees The NCS take its rightful place in the scientific publishing community, positioned as the bridge between complex scientific research and the average scientist’s comprehension.
Scientists across the globe can testify to the challenges of accessing and understanding the latest scientific advancements published in high-tier journals. An unfortunate side effect of this situation is that research often remains confined within a limited sphere of specialized scientists. Recognizing this issue, NCS seeks to invite scientists who have published in these prestigious journals to reconsider their research for the wider scientific audience. We will extend an invitation to authors to elucidate their research on online social media platforms, aiming to simplify these complex studies and make them more accessible and comprehensible to average researchers. Our mission is to make cutting-edge science accessible and comprehensible to all scientists, irrespective of their field of expertise.
We are eager to serve scientists by rapidly and efficiently publishing significant advances across all scientific fields. Our focus is on originality, importance, interdisciplinary interest, timeliness, accessibility, elegance, and surprising conclusions. We also aim to serve as a platform for robust discussion and commentary on topical trends affecting the scientific community, thereby contributing to the vibrant discourse surrounding scientific issues. Moreover, we aim to quickly disseminate the outcomes of scientific endeavors to the public, underscoring the impact they have on knowledge, culture, and everyday life.
Our predilection for research inclusive of all biomedical disciplines, with a particular focus on oncology, neuroscience, immunology, genetics, and ophthalmology, remains a cornerstone of NCS’s vision. Translational research, bridging the often-chasmic gap between laboratory and bedside, will find a dedicated and enthusiastic audience here. We firmly believe that these efforts will help to advance understanding of disease pathogenesis at the molecular level.
We have designed our publication sections to cater to various categories of scientific expression, including original research articles, review articles, short communications, editorials, commentaries, and opinions. Furthermore, we welcome diverse topics within these sections, spanning numerous biomedical fields. The submitted articles will be subjected to a conventional peer-review process to ensure originality and to stimulate further research.
